There is a similar true story that was made into a movie with Richard Gere.  It was Hachi:A Dog's Tale (2009).  He was a Japenese Akita and he would go to the train station everyday to meet his owner and continued to do so for nine years after the owner passed away until Hachi himself died.  It's a sad story but heartwarming.   It was filmed right here in RI at an old train station.    There is a statue of Hachi at the train station in Japan, he was a very special dog.
